TIPS FOR CREATING THE PERFECT NAUTICAL PALETTE
1) Beach glass is one of the most versatile accessories for a seaside wedding: scattered across serving dishes, glowing inside clear vessels, or layered with place cards, it’s instantly evocative of the best of the beach.
2) Be considerate to your non ~ seafood eating guests and expand your sea ~ inspired menu to include options from the field or forest as well. An option other than seafood will be appreciated.
